Using only NCAA Tournament performance in the modern era (1979-2019). The '79 Tournament was the first one to use seeding and it was the first to also expand outside of just 32 teams. Here's how the scoring works:

NCAA Appearances that end...

First Round (40-68 teams): 1 point
Second Round (Round of 32): 2 points
Sweet 16: 4 points
Elite 8: 7 points
Final 4: 15 points
Final 2: 20 points
National Champs: 30 points

Here's the Top 10 Programs Overall:

1. Duke- 373
2. N. Carolina- 360
3. Kentucky- 299
4. Kansas- 274
5. Michigan St.- 223
6. UConn- 195
7. UCLA- 191
8. Louisville- 191
9. Syracuase- 175
10. Arizona- 166

Here's how the SEC stacks up:

3. Kentucky- 299
13. Florida- 157
16. Arkansas- 121
27. LSU- 79
41. Missouri- 55
44. Tennessee- 48
47. Alabama- 47
55. Auburn- 41
64. Texas A&M- 31
67. Miss St.- 30
68. Georgia- 29
71. Vanderbilt- 27
89. S. Carolina- 19
112. Ole Miss- 14

Looks like those same Top 6 in the league will add to their totals this year, further separating themselves a bit.

True, but the NCAA Tournament in those days was nothing like it is today. Arkansas made the Final Four in 1941.... the Tournament started with just 8 teams and only one team per conference was invited (some leagues didn't get even one invite, such as the SEC that year).

It's hard to reward a Final Four in 1941 that only required one Tournament win to get there to a modern-day Final 4 appearance. It's basically apples and oranges.
